+const mora = [
+ "a", "i", "u", "e", "o", "ya", "yu", "yo", "wa",
+ "ka", "ki", "ku", "ke", "ko", "ga", "gi", "gu", "ge", "go",
+ "sa", "shi", "su", "se", "so", "za", "ji", "zu", "ze", "zo",
+ "ta", "chi", "tsu", "te", "to", "da", "de", "do",
+ "na", "ni", "nu", "ne", "no", "ha", "hi", "fu", "he", "ho",
+ "pa", "pi", "pu", "pe", "po", "ba", "bi", "bu", "be", "bo",
+ "ma", "mi", "mu", "me", "mo", "ra", "ri", "ru", "re", "ro",
+ "kya", "kyu", "kyo", "gya", "gyu", "gyo", "sha", "shu", "sho",
+ "ja", "ju", "jo", "cha", "chu", "cho", "nya", "nyu", "nyo",
+ "hya", "hyu", "hyo", "pya", "pyu", "pyo", "bya", "byu", "byo",
+ "mya", "myu", "myo", "rya", "ryu", "ryo"
+];
+
+const digit = [
+ "0", "1", "2", "3", "4",
+ "5", "6", "7", "8", "9"
+];
+
+const symbol = [
+ "!", "#", "@", "$", "%",
+ "^", "&", "*", "?", "/"
+];
+
+const crypto = require('crypto');
+
+function jp_hash(input)
+{
+ const hash = crypto.createHash('sha256').update(input).digest();
+ let word = [];
+ let ms = [];
+
+ for (let i = 0; i < 9; i++)
+ word[i] = hash.readUInt16LE(2*i);
+
+ for (i = 0; i < 6; i++)
+ ms[i] = mora[word[i] % mora.length];
+
+ const dig = digit[word[6] % digit.length];
+ const sym = symbol[word[7] % symbol.length];
+
+ ms[0] = ms[0][0].toUpperCase() + ms[0].slice(1);
+
+ switch (word[8] & 7) {
+ case 0:
+ return [ms[0], ms[1], ms[2], sym, ms[3], ms[4], ms[5], dig].join('');
+ case 1:
+ return [sym, ms[0], ms[1], ms[2], dig, ms[3], ms[4], ms[5]].join('');
+ case 2:
+ return [ms[0], ms[1], sym, ms[2], ms[3], dig, ms[4], ms[5]].join('');
+ case 3:
+ return [ms[0], ms[1], dig, ms[2], ms[3], sym, ms[4], ms[5]].join('');
+ case 4:
+ return [ms[0], ms[1], ms[2], "n", sym, ms[3], ms[4], ms[5], dig].join('');
+ case 5:
+ return [sym, ms[0], ms[1], ms[2], dig, ms[3], ms[4], ms[5], "n"].join('');
+ case 6:
+ return [ms[0], ms[1], "n", sym, ms[2], ms[3], dig, ms[4], ms[5]].join('');
+ case 7:
+ return [ms[0], ms[1], dig, ms[2], ms[3], sym, ms[4], ms[5], "n"].join('');
+ }
+}
